Late rally comes up short at Bethel

Bethel University 3, UW-Stout 2

ARDEN HILLS, Minn  (September 11, 2008) - Bethel University scored the first three goals of the game, but UW-Stout came back to score two goals in the final 20 minutes of the game to put a scare in the undefeated Royals, Thursday, as Bethel squeaked out a 3-2 win.

The Royals' (6-0-0) Kylie Dirks scored in the 29th minute, then added another goal in the 59th minute. Bethel's goalkeeper, Charli Sorensen, got into the scoring column, striking home with a penalty kick in the 64th minute.

Stout's Grace Salwasser (Fr, Cottage Grove, Minn) scored in the 70th minute on an assist by Cassie Palokangas (So, Apple Valley, Minn). Palokangas added an unassisted goal in the 81st minute.

The Blue Devil (1-3-1) defense held Bethel to only seven shots on net. Overall, Bethel outshot Stout, 10-8.

Stout opens conference play Saturday, Sept. 13 when they are at UW-Stevens Point. Stout's first home game is Wednesday, Sept. 17 when they will host UW-River Falls at 7 p.m.
